Output 044038d7c5e91cf66ae87abc91c7ffd62b8472cff7f1ac03f12911d840186b4c:2

value
66941191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1258832eb2591aaa507a6d5480101083a8d5266a OP_EQUAL
address
M9aARqN7BMyMd1wsvSEMQciL8WcoAZG9ZW
transaction
044038d7c5e91cf66ae87abc91c7ffd62b8472cff7f1ac03f12911d840186b4c
spent
true